The Evolving Paradigm of Content Strategy
Historically, content marketing focused on producing volume—more blog posts, more videos, more coverage. However, recent industry trends indicate that quality and strategic alignment command higher engagement and conversion rates. According to recent data from the Content Marketing Institute, 80% of top-performing brands prioritize strategic planning over ad hoc content creation.
Modern content strategy transcends mere output; it embodies a comprehensive understanding of target audiences, data-driven decision-making, and an integrated approach that aligns with broader business objectives. Key Components of a Robust Digital Content Strategy
| Component | Description | Industry Insight |
|---|---|---|
| Audience Segmentation | Precise profiling to tailor messaging effectively. | Advanced segmentation increases engagement rates by up to 30% (Forrester). |
| Content Framework | Structure that aligns content types with user journeys. | Frameworks such as the Hub & Spoke Model optimize content flow and SEO impact. |
| Data Analytics | Tracking performance to inform iteration and ROI. | Data-driven companies outperform competitors by 20% in revenue growth (McKinsey). |
| Distribution & Amplification | Channels selection and content promotion strategies. | Multichannel campaigns yield 24% higher engagement (Hootsuite). |
